Frequently Asked Questions
Is Duck Sauce safe for people with kidney disease?
Duck Sauce is rated Avoid for CKD patients. Avoid or eat rarely if you have CKD. With 9.0mg phosphorus, 712.0mg sodium, and 87.0mg potassium per 100.0g serving, it is best avoided or eaten only on special occasions. Always confirm with your nephrologist or renal dietitian.
How much phosphorus is in Duck Sauce?
A 100.0g serving of Duck Sauce contains 9mg of phosphorus, which is approximately 1% of the recommended 1,000mg daily lim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
How much sodium is in Duck Sauce?
Per 100.0g serving, Duck Sauce provides 712mg of sodium — about 31% of the 2,300mg daily sodium limit recommended for kidney patients.
How much potassium is in Duck Sauce?
Duck Sauce contains 87mg of potassium per 100.0g serving, equivalent to about 4% of the daily 2,000mg potassium lim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
